Transaction 042d63c21c643091a7d51d5486eefc4e8ec07d1a40275aba527e2a63b464d882

2 Input
2 Outputs
  • 042d63c21c643091a7d51d5486eefc4e8ec07d1a40275aba527e2a63b464d882:0
  • value  794872
    address  3MHbfs6FDtQeypmk41hXza3w9EGvPF6buj
  • 042d63c21c643091a7d51d5486eefc4e8ec07d1a40275aba527e2a63b464d882:1
  • value  416412
    address  1MCs1Xm9Jm6KLpDKLizh8vYcTaS16RdawA